🚇 🗺️ Getting There
Rue de Bourgogne is located in the heart of Dijon's historic center. It's easily accessible on foot from most central hotels. If arriving by train, the Dijon-Ville station is a pleasant 15-20 minute walk away. Local buses also serve the area, with stops near the Place Darcy.
Yes, Rue de Bourgogne is a walkable distance from Dijon-Ville train station. The walk takes approximately 15-20 minutes through the charming city streets.
Parking in the immediate vicinity of Rue de Bourgogne can be challenging due to its pedestrian-friendly nature. Several public parking garages are available nearby, such as Parking Darcy or Parking Grangier, which are a short walk away.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
No, Rue de Bourgogne is a public street and does not require an entrance ticket. You can explore it freely at any time.
Shop opening hours on Rue de Bourgogne generally follow typical European retail schedules, usually from around 9:30 AM to 7:00 PM, with some variations and potential closures on Sundays or public holidays. It's best to check individual shop hours if you have specific places in mind.
